25 06 2023
Git 分支管理是团队协作开发中必不可少的一环,对于团队成员代码的协同开发和版本控制有着重要的作用。下面我将从以下几个方面回答如何进行 Git 分支管理。 一、Git 分支的基本概念 1.主分支(master): 是 Git 默认的分支。所有的提交都会记录在这个分支上。 2.开发分支(develop): 用于日常开发。所有的功能合并到这个分支中。 3.特性分支(feature): 用于某个特定功能的开发。当这个功能完成后,可以合并到 develop 分支中。 4.发布分支(release): 用于发布一个版本。在这个分支上,完成最后的测试、修复 bug 和文档编写等工作后,可以将这个版本合并到 master 和 develop 分支中。 5.热修复分支(hotfix):用于紧急修复 master 分支中的 bug,修复后可以将这个分支合并到 master 分支和 develop 分支中。 二、Git 分支的使用流程 1.创建分支:使用 git branch 命令创建分支,并切换到这个分支(git checkout 命令)。 2.修改代码:在当前分支上进行代码修改。 3.提交修改:使用 git add 和 git commit 命令将修改提交到当前分支。 4.合并分支:使用 git merge 命令将当前分支合并到目标分支,如将 feature 分支合并到 develop 分支中。 5.删除分支:使用 git branch -d 命令删除已经不需要的分支。 三、Git 分支管理的注意事项 1.每个分支只做一件事情,避免分支功能的交叉影响。 2.分支的命名规范并非固定,建议以功能为命名依据,避免冲突。 3.在合并分支时,需要保证代码冲突的解决,特别是多人协作开发时。 4.及时删除不需要的分支,保持 Git 仓库的整洁。 四、Git 分支管理实践 通过以上基本概念和使用流程的介绍,我们可以根据团队的具体情况进行 Git 的分支管理实践。例如,在一个团队中,可以设立 master、develop、feature_xxx 等分支,团队成员可以在相应的分支上进行代码编写和修改,并通过合并操作将代码提交到主分支中,达到团队协作开发的目的。 总之,Git 分支管理对于团队协作开发非常重要,良好的分支管理能够提高团队开发效率,保障代码质量。因此,建议团队成员在日常开发时,始终按照分支管理的标准流程进行,不断总结经验和方法,提高代码的质量和管理的效率。
延伸阅读
    如何正确认识全球能源安全形式
    团结带领青年建功新时代
    RAM、ROM和flash的区别
    工商管理学院办公室助理的工作分析的成果 招聘要求或胜任力模型
    运输问题处理后可以用匈牙利法求解吗